I have SDSL, 768Kbps at work, a 2Mbps x 2Mbps Cable connection at work and 384Kbps at home.

Let me tell you, 768Kbps is sweet, 2Mbps, right now, to me, is the Holy Grail.

When I RDP into my home machine at 384Kbps, it's slow, painful and extremely laggy (VNC is even worse).

When I RDP into the machines connected to our SDSL at 768Kbps, it's MUCH more bareable, but I still experience the occasional slowdown.

When I RDP into the machine connected to the 2Mbps line, HOLY! It's like I'm sitting at the machine.

I hope the cable companies don't try to appease us with a measly 512Kbps upload, (had it during the "brief" RR Xtreme trials and it's nothing worth mentioning), we need a full 1Mbps in my not so humble opinion.
